Daniel 7:18
New American Standard Bible
18 But the [a](A)saints of the Highest One will (B)receive the kingdom and take possession of the kingdom forever, [b]for all ages to come.’

Daniel 7:27
New American Standard Bible
27 Then the [a](A)sovereignty, the dominion, and the greatness of all the kingdoms under the whole heaven will be given to the people of the [b]saints of the Highest One; His kingdom will be an (B)everlasting kingdom, and all the empires will (C)serve and obey Him.’

Matthew 19:28
New American Standard Bible
28 And Jesus said to them, “Truly I say to you, that you who have followed Me, in the [a]regeneration when (A)the Son of Man will sit on [b]His glorious throne, (B)you also shall sit upon twelve thrones, judging the twelve tribes of Israel.

Romans 5:17
New American Standard Bible
17 For if by the offense of the one, death reigned (A)through the one, much more will those who receive the abundance of grace and of the gift of righteousness (B)reign in life through the One, Jesus Christ.

Revelation 20:4
New American Standard Bible
4 Then I saw (A)thrones, and (B)they sat on them, and (C)judgment was given to them. And I saw (D)the souls of those who had been beheaded because of [a]their (E)testimony of Jesus and because of the word of God, and those who had not (F)worshiped the beast or his image, and had not received the (G)mark on their foreheads and on their hands; and they (H)came to life and (I)reigned with Christ for a thousand years.
